For example, click the page number by any heading or procedure. Excel vba tutorials will help you to learn vba from basics to advanced programming concepts. When you are satisfied with the macro, you can add a button to the toolbar for the macro so that you can simply click the button to run the. Vba programming in office this reference is for experienced office users who want to learn about vba and who want some insight into how programming can help them to customize office. Click or scroll to zoom tap or pinch to zoom visual basic for applications vba 20 quick reference. Acrobat create pdf would allow me to convert an excel to pdf with hyperlinks included. Visual basic for applications vba 20 quick guide card. If you are new to vba, consider learning vba from basics.
Vba for excel cheat sheet by guslong download free from. We use wild card characters to match a particular pattern, we use like operator with wild card characters to match it in a string. I appreciate that yes, that image is not returning that. Includes material from r for beginners by emmanuel paradis with permission.
Press after selecting a cell range to make it an absolute reference. How to use wildcard characters in vba excel learn vba. Apply for and manage the va benefits and services youve earned as a veteran, servicemember, or family memberlike health care, disability, education, and more. Select the cell range that contains the data you want to chart and click the chart wizard button on the standard toolbar. Select a recent file or navigate to the location where the file is. This vba quick reference guide provides a list of functions for vba in excel. Vba quick ref page 4 vba reference card line continuation. Jul 15, 2015 welcome to my endtoend vba cheat sheet. Office visual basic for applications vba is an eventdriven programming language that enables you to extend office applications. This guide will help you prepare for cfis vba modeling course.
Vba stands for visual basic for applications, a powerful programming available in the ms office. T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. Excel vba programming for dummies cheat sheet dummies. Vba userform a guide for everyone excel macro mastery. Vba code colors black regular code bluekeywords greencomments red errors variable data types bln boolean true 1 or false 0. From a quick vba macro to a full blown application based on the raisers edge object api, you can find what you need here. Download our free excel vba cheat sheet pdf for quick reference. The idea being that you increase your efficiency when you limit the number of instances your hands have. Libreoffice basic ide download pdf source file odt libreoffice basic overview download pdf source file odt libreoffice basic calc download pdf source file odt libreoffice basic runtime library download pdf. Vba quick reference guide learn vba functions, shortcuts. Language reference for visual basic for applications vba. In a pdf, page numbers in the table of contents, index, and all crossreferences are hyperlinks. Vvbbaa qquuiicckk gguuiiddee vba stands for visual basic for applications an event driven programming language from microsoft that is now predominantly used with microsoft office applications such as msexcel, msword and msaccess. It provides a practical way for your application to get information from the user.
Vba quick guide vba stands for visual basic for applications an eventdriven programming language from microsoft that is now predominantly used with microsoft office applicatio. This reference contains conceptual overviews, programming tasks, samples, and references to help you develop excel solutions. Mar 03, 2017 armed with this new procedure i was quickly able to identify the source of my problems, the server admins had mixed office application versions so my early binding libraries yes, this db was created long before i discovered the benefits of late binding were missing because i was told they were running office 2010, when in fact they were running access 2010 with excel and word 2007. After creating the macro and declaring the variables, the next step is to create vba cell references, which actually refer to each variable and that can then be used to manipulate the data within the excel sheet. I am trying to automatically control nuance power pdf to merge pdf files and create table of contents and bookmarks using excel vba macro.
Training guides for outlook for office 365, excel 2019, photoshop, lightroom, and sharepoint. Using the vba essentials guide, your technical staff can learn how to use the optional module vba for advanced customisation to customise the raisers edge for your organisations policies and procedures. Select a recent file or navigate to the location where the file is saved. Find answers to manipulating pdfs from vbvba pdf library.
Thank you for reading cfis vba quick reference guide to help you get ready for vba modeling in excel. Among vba, excel vba is the most popular one and the reason for using vba is that we can build very powerful tools in ms excel using linear programming. Nifenecker reference cards for quick access to libreoffice basic programming. Excel vba cheat sheet ultimate vba reference and code snippets.
This reference is for experienced office users who want to learn about vba and who want some insight into how programming can help them to customize office. This excel vba reference should become your primary source of information. Others are according to preference, including font in editor format consolas, fixedsys are better than courier. Quick reference card quick access toolbar title bar close button ribbon status bar navigation pane scroll bar free quick references visit ref. The vba developers guide is designed to teach the basics of using vba with microsoft dynamics gp. Worksheetssheet1 or sheetssheet1 a cell or range in a1 convention. To learn more on vba file functions, we suggest that you go take this course on vba macros. Click the home tab and click the spelling button, or press f7. If you are new to vba start with my excel vba tutorial. Download the basic reference cards from our macros documentation web page and get the original odt file to translate these handy card in your native language. Select the data you want to copy, click the copy button on the home tab, then click where you want to paste the data, and click the paste button.
Website members have access to the full webinar archive. This excel vba save as pdf tutorial is accompanied by files containing the data and macros i use in the examples below. If the macro does not pass the test and does not work correctly, you do not have to delete it and start over. Visual basic for applications makes automation possible in excel and other office applications. This reference contains conceptual overviews, programming tasks, samples, and references to guide you in developing solutions based on vba. A simple function to list the reference libraries used by a vba project and their status. Office visual basic for applications vba reference. Speaking of functions, the table following shows excel vba functions and what they accomplish. Laminated microsoft office 20 quick reference card showing stepbystep instructions and shortcuts for how to use features that are common to wor. For example, if we use s with like operator, then we are searching for a string which starts with a capital s and there can be multiple characters after s. Excel vba cheat sheet ultimate vba reference and code. Nuance power pdf automation using excel vba macro stack.
Just download the pdf version and print it in thick paper to have a quick access to information that you probably know it exist, but you forgot how to make it work. Vba syntax, variables, loops, conditions, classes, types, enumerations etc. Home visual basic for applications vba 20 quick reference. Please see office vba support and feedback for guidance about the ways you can receive support and. This section of freevbcode provides free code on the topic of office vba. Getting help most r functions have online documentation. Suppose the workbook that will have the vba codes is on desktop and you have acrobat pro. Passing arguments by value byval the alternative is to pass arguments by value, which means that you are passing a copy of the argument, and not a reference to where it is stored. If you are a member of the website, click on the image below to view the webinar for this post. Excel shortcut keys allow you to perform certain tasks using only the keyboard. If i do exportasfixedformat the links get flattened. Note that the csv file has three fields and that the fields are separated by commas. The office 20 vba documentation download provides an offline version of the visual basic for applications vba developer reference for each of the office client applications, as well as the vba reference content shared amongst all office client applications office shared. Vba programmers guide part number e5061900x3, attached to option aba this manual describes programming information for performing automatic measurement with internal controller.
Vba cell references allow the user to tell excel where to look for the data it needs. You can help protect yourself from scammers by verifying that the contact is a microsoft agent or microsoft employee and that the phone number is an official microsoft global customer service number. A wealth of programming samples are provided to illustrate key concepts and provide you with a solid foundation on. Ive set my reference in the vbe and can create an object and access. The basic vba method you use for converting excel files to pdf is exportasfixedformat. To continue progressing your career, these additional cfi resources will be helpful. If r is nothing test for nil reference partition22, 0, 100, 10 20. How do i merge certain pages from different pdf files with. Excel vba programming functions visual basic for applications vba gives experienced excel users a wide range of options for creating excel spreadsheets and customizing how they look and function. I found some information on how to accomplish this task using adobes acrobat, but i havent found anything regarding nuance power pdf. May 19, 2015 visual basic for applications vba 20 quick reference guide. The image above illustrates only a very small portion of excels vba object hierarchy. Application of vba you might wonder why we need to use vba in excel as msexcel itself provides loads on inbuilt functions.
Stepbystep guide and 10 code examples to export excel to pdf. From excel vba programming for dummies, 5th edition. Do the modulelevel declaration of the array, assign to the first cell any value of your choice. My process already creates pdf files, i just need to know how to reference these pdfs via vb vba code and manipulate it then save and close. Loops, conditions, variable declaration and so on will be presented and complete programming notions already presented in the previous lab. How to record a macro declare procedures decision structures. Provides reference materials for the excel object model. Be sure to bookmark this page as your excel vba cheat sheet visual basic for applications makes automation possible in excel and other office applications. Excel quick reference basic skills the excel program screen keyboard shortcuts getting started create a workbook. We provide extraordinary vision and dental benefits, the best group coverage options, and outstanding service for our members. Please feel free to share this pdf with anyone for free. The reason you dont need to do this is that it is the default behaviour in vba. Part 1, using vba, provides information on how you can program windows, window fields, grids and reports, as well as store additional application data.
Inselectext body, declare an array of same size and datatype asmyarray in which the length of the 1st selected word will be assigned to its 1st cell and display the result in a message box. View notes vba quick ref from finance 4534 at houston baptist university. Loop through files in a folder with vba modified to only loop through the pdfs combine pdfs with vba and adobe acrobat must add a reference to adobe acrobat x. Basic vba syntax, loops, variables, arrays, classes and more. You can get immediate free access to these example files by subscribing to the power spreadsheets newsletter. Aug 25, 2009 excel offers myriad options for referring to workbooks and sheets in your vba code. The below excel vba cheatsheet is your one stop shop for a variety of useful vba automations. To use like operator with wild card characters in vba excel. Vba stands for visual basic for applications an eventdriven programming language from microsoft that is now predominantly used with microsoft office applications such as msexcel, msword, and msaccess it helps techies to build customized applications and solutions to enhance the capabilities of those applications.
Have questions or feedback about office vba or this documentation. Engg1811 vba reference card vba language structure part a. Export report as pdf file using vba in access 20072016 with adobe acrobat 20182019 we have a shared access database where one user had their adobe acrobat reader dc updated to the newest 20182019 version. You can start learning from this free tutorial based on your experience and expertise in vba. This excel vba save as pdf tutorial is accompanied by files containing the data and macros i. Excel office client development support and feedback. Using vba, a program developer can create custom business rules, design custom screens, create web site interfaces, and much more.
Visual basic for applications vba 20 quick reference guide. Notice that the title of this book isnt the complete guide to excel vba. Engg1811 vba reference card editor access and setup developer tab, visual basic button. Select the cell range that contains the data you want to chart and. If you want to see the huge amount of vba objects excel has, take a look at excels 2007 object model map or excels object model reference. Using vba how do i call up the adobe create pdf function. Also, ms word is used as the primary application platform for this. May 11, 2012 find answers to manipulating pdfs from vbvba pdf library.
905 479 1232 439 53 179 1043 72 1034 1233 268 766 309 247 1126 103 1449 872 802 241 597 1014 844 652 1297 232 974 125 373 943 154